This coupe likes to give you classic style with the right upgrades
subtly added. For example, you could get a black Chevelle in '67,
but it never had the depth that's presented here. It was an upgrade
as part of a newer restoration. When you know you're going to
upgrade a car to a piano-like black, then you make sure the body
panels are straight and clean for an impressive overall
presentation. And they also took care of the details with clean
glass and nice brightwork trim - including those big wraparound
chrome bumpers. It has been upgraded correctly to a Super Sport
with the dual power dome hood, ribbed rockers, SS badging, and
fender callouts all sending a powerful message. And the wheels fit
with the theme of subtle upgrades. They look like classic Rally
units, but they are actually a larger size with a 17/18-inch
front/rear stagger to give this a more aggressive stance and let
you fit better modern tires.
It will be hard to resist leaving all the windows down on this
pillarless hardtop because it just looks so cool with the red
interior radiating from the black exterior. It's a style that we
don't see too often, but it's absolutely perfect for an
intimidating muscle car. And you'll also appreciate the quality,
with everything from headliner to the carpeting feeling quite
fresh. You'll value classic details everywhere from the detailed
trim of the door panels to the working dome light. And just like
the exterior, there are also well-integrated upgrades. The stereo
is a retro-style AM/FM stereo w/aux input, and this now has a
Vintage Air cold-blowing air conditioning system. It's also a true
driver's car with front bucket seats, a center console in-between,
a Hurst floor shifter, and a three-spoke SS steering wheel now on a
tilt column.
Lift the hood to see a tidy presentation that's full of power. This
is an era-correct 396 cubic-inch V8 block, and it's ready to show
off with the bold block color, shining valve covers, and matching
air topper all commanding attention in the engine bay. It inhales
deeply with a four-barrel carburetor, and it exhales with power
into the X-pipe dual exhaust and MagnaFlow mufflers. You'll also
spot the right supporting components like an HEI distributor and an
aluminum radiator. The Muncie four-speed manual transmission gives
you full control over the power as it feeds the 12-bolt rear end.
There's also power steering, power brakes, front discs, and grip of
ZR-rated tires to give you a solid driver feeling out on the
road.
